- Can anyone explain why MX displays only my name in the "To:" header
- when a colleague has sent the message to several names via a distribution
- list from a Sun workstation?
-
- The colleague says on Sun's, the received message's "To:" header shows
- the complete list. But on MX v3.1B, only one name is shown.
-
- By the "To:" header, I mean the actual header as printed within the
- long list of various headers, not the "To:" extracted for VMSmail and
- displayed by VMSmail at the top.
-
- Not having any indication the message was originally sent to a list is
- confusing to the recipient.
